Canary now holds at 5% until error-rate and latency checks pass two consecutive windows. Auto-rollback fires on a single hard-fail window. Manual override requires release-manager approval in the Foxglove console. No change to baseline traffic routing; gating only affects promotion timing. Rollout: merge, then enable the flag per service starting with the quieter queues. Tested against last week's Driftmoor incident replay — rollback triggered in 90 seconds. Gate thresholds and window sizes are as follows.

constants for fafof-yadug:
QUOTAS = {
    "gorael": 575,
    "kasok": 31,
}

The nightly reconciliation job for the Larkspur warehouse system compares stock counts between the Tillage ledger and the Pondview fulfillment cache. Every run is stamped with the exact build that produced it, so discrepancies can always be traced back to a specific artifact. New team members should verify provenance before filing a mismatch report, since stale builds are the most common cause of false alarms. Check the deploy manifest first, then the job log header. The current verified build token appears below.

trace token, kahog-tajeg: htk6_97d963

# ProctorLine Queue — Environments

ProctorLine handles exam-session intake for Quillmark Academy clients. Three environments: dev, staging, prod. Staging mirrors prod capacity at 25%. Queue depth alerts route to the support rotation. Do not replay sessions in prod without a supervisor flag. The staging environment currently runs with the following configuration values.

settings of tagef-bawif:
DRUIX_HOST=druix.zemvarlabs.internal
DRUIX_PORT=8000

## Environments: Gatecount Turnstile Counter

The Gatecount service tallies turnstile entries at Harrowmere Stadium and exposes per-gate totals to plugins. Plugin authors should note that the sandbox environment replays a recorded match day, while staging connects to live hardware in read-only mode. Rate limits and flush intervals differ between the two, so never hard-code timing assumptions. Each environment's settings for the counting core are listed below.

service settings:
[casax]
port = 6379
team = rusir
host = casax.zemvarhq.corp
region = outer-4
access_code = ac_9808ce
timeout_ms = 1500